Bloomingdale's
Bloomingdale's is a luxury department store that has more than 100 years of history. The store offers a wide range of high-end clothes and accessories. The store provides a variety of services, such as free WiFi and multilingual assistance for non-English-speaking customers. There is also a wide range of dining options. The store is a great place to spend your day shopping and enjoying delicious food.
The first Bloomingdale's opened in New York City, in 1861. The company was founded in 1861 by the brothers Lyman Bloomingdale and Samuel Bloomingdale. The company sold a wide range of products that included women's clothing, men's wool suits, and upright pianos. By 1929, the department store had expanded and became one of the city's most popular. In 1930 it merged with Federated Department Stores, which was later acquired by Macy's, Inc.

The Frankie Shop
The Frankie Shop has been a staple in the wardrobes of fashion bloggers and social media stars since its launch on the scene in 2014. Founder Gaelle Drevet launched the store with the aim of catering to women who "feel that being stylish does not have to be perfect." The brand is also a favorite among celebrities like Hailey Bieber and Gigi Hadid. It is available in luxury department stores such as Net-a-Porter.
The brand's oversized blazers and dresses are designed to be worn as casual outfits with the slouchy silhouette giving a hint of edge. The collection of the label are inspired by Paris and New York are a sophisticated feminine take on minimalism. The label has been able to establish a loyal following of influencers who regularly share their Frankie Shop purchase with the hashtag #frankiegirl.
In a period when many multi-brand retailers are struggling, The Frankie Shop has found success by keeping its inventory tightly controlled. The brand is able to test market trends using its limited inventory, and also increase the demand for their products. This strategy has been successful since the pieces of the brand are regularly sold out and replenished in a just a few days.
